Latest Patents
Harris holds a patent for a fuel mixer designed to optimize fuel-air mixtures for engine combustors. The innovative fuel mixer consists of a mixer body that includes a mixer outer wall and a center body, with an annular passageway between them. Central to the design is the fuel tube assembly that is strategically placed around the mixer body. This assembly features multiple fuel channels that facilitate the injection of fuel into the annular passageway, enhancing the combustion process. Notably, the design incorporates mechanisms for cooling, which can affect both the boundary layer flow and the mixer components, ensuring improved efficiency in fuel usage.
